Maintenance and Operational Considerations

Owning a private jet entails substantial financial responsibilities that extend beyond the initial purchase price. Regular maintenance is essential to ensure safety and airworthiness, which includes inspections, repairs, and adherence to aviation regulations. These costs can accumulate significantly over time, especially for infrequent travellers who may not use the aircraft often enough to justify the expenditure. In contrast, opting for private jet charter in Wedderburn, Victoria, eliminates these ongoing maintenance concerns. Clients pay only for the flights they take, allowing for more predictable budgeting without the burdens of ownership.

Operational responsibilities also differ markedly between ownership and charter. Jet ownership requires managing logistics, including scheduling, staffing, and hangar facilities, which can be time-consuming and complex. For those who travel infrequently, this can lead to inefficiencies and increased stress. However, with private jet charter in Wedderburn, Victoria, clients benefit from a streamlined process where charter companies handle all operational aspects, allowing passengers to focus solely on their travel plans. This convenience offers a more accessible travel experience, particularly for individuals who may not have the time or desire to manage the intricacies of aircraft ownership.

What are the main costs associated with owning a private jet?

The main costs of owning a private jet include acquisition costs, maintenance and operational expenses, insurance, hangar fees, and staff salaries. These costs can add up significantly, making ownership less economical for infrequent travellers.

How do charter flight costs typically compare to owning a jet?

Charter flight costs are generally based on hourly rates, which can be more cost-effective for individuals who travel infrequently, as they only pay for the hours they use the aircraft without the long-term financial commitment of ownership.

What are the maintenance responsibilities for jet owners?

Jet owners are responsible for regular maintenance, inspections, and repairs to ensure the aircraft remains safe and compliant with aviation regulations. This can be time-consuming and costly compared to the hassle-free experience of chartering.
